use the lim f(x)-f(a)/x-a to find the derivative
x->a

f(x)=-3x^2-5x+1 and point (1,-7)

The questions where asking to compute for the derivative of x->a, and base on my own calculation and further computation about the said function, the derivative of x->a is  \[f'(x)=-6x-5\] and if you replace x by 1 here you will get \[f'(1)=-11\].
